Yongin FC, a new team in the K League 2, recorded a moving first victory after eight opening matches. Before the game, head coach Choi Yoon-kyeom had said, "I have been blaming myself for the prolonged winless streak," and now he finally let out a sigh of relief.
Under the leadership of head coach Choi Yoon-kyeom, Yongin defeated Gimhae 4-1 in a home match of the Hana Bank K League 2 2026 Round 9 held at Yongin Mir Stadium on the 26th. This victory ended a seven-match winless run (three draws and four losses) since the season opener, marking the club's first win in its history.
On this day, Yongin took the lead with Gabriel's opening goal just two minutes into the first half. They then added consecutive goals from Seok Hyun-jun and Kim Min-woo in the 17th and 36th minutes of the first half, respectively, securing an early advantage. With Seok Hyun-jun's goal in the fourth minute of the second half, Yongin ultimately celebrated their first win of the season with a decisive 4-1 victory.
Head coach Choi Yoon-kyeom said, "It feels like we waited too long. I want to convey to the fans that even though we won, I am truly sorry it took so long. Since last July, I have put a lot of effort into player selection. The poor results caused me great mental strain and difficult times. While not everything has been healed, I will strive to have the players bond firmly and achieve consecutive victories with strong performances, using today as a turning point."
The coach added, "Many people have waited for us. The club owner, Mayor Lee Sang-il, has also waited. Many people put in effort during the club's founding process. Many individuals related to the city worked hard during the founding process. I have been sorry for that. I felt deeply apologetic. I am sorry that the first victory came so late to our ardent supporters and the citizens who have quietly cheered for us. Today, seeing everyone celebrate so joyfully has helped heal the difficult parts we endured. I want to create more days of joy."

Head coach Choi Yoon-kyeom stated, "In fact, the players also went through very difficult times. It was my lack that prevented us from achieving results. Fortunately, the players worked hard, showed good gameplay, and brought home the results. I think Seok Hyun-jun scoring two goals is also a positive sign."
Head coach Choi Yoon-kyeom identified "desperation" as the key factor for the victory. He said, "The players tried hard to win one game for me, but the results didn't come. I also waited without putting pressure on the players and instilled positive confidence, which eventually became mutual trust and belief. Because those feelings were conveyed, I think the joy was doubled. This is a victory for everyone that everyone should enjoy. I want to give credit to all the stakeholders."
The coach remarked, "Perhaps because we couldn't win for seven games and finally did, it felt particularly urgent for me personally. If we had lost this time, we would have dropped to last place, and I wondered how I should take responsibility. Because of that sense of responsibility and weight, I felt very apologetic. If I had to name a hidden hero, it would be Kim Min-woo. He changed positions during pre-season training and showed a lot during friendly matches. He scored a goal and also provided an assist."
Continuing, head coach Choi Yoon-kyeom said, "For now, let's enjoy today, and from tomorrow, we will need to prepare for the Seongnam match. Now that we have secured our first win, I'm not sure if I should say this, but if we can maintain this winning momentum and atmosphere, I think we can aim for the eighth-place position we targeted, and even look forward to a playoff berth. If we continue winning, I believe the gap with other teams will quickly narrow."
